Fall Creek Falls State Park

Fall Creek Falls State Park is a popular destination for n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ts. This state park in Tennessee offers breathtaking views of waterfalls, lush forests, and diverse wildlife.

The park is home to the highest waterfall east of the Mississippi River, Fall Creek Falls, which cascades down 256 feet. Visitors can enjoy various activities, such as hiking, camping, fishing, and birdwatching.

The park also features picnic areas, playgrounds, and a nature center. With its natural beauty and recreational opportunities, Fall Creek Falls State Park is a must-visit for anyone exploring the natural wonders of Tennessee.

Ruby Falls

Ruby Falls is a stunning underground waterfall located in Chattanooga, Tennessee. It is one of the most popular tourist attractions in the state, drawing visitors from all over the world.

The falls are located deep within Lookout Mountain and can be accessed through a guided tour.

The tour takes visitors through narrow passageways and into a large cavern where the waterfall is located. The sight of the cascading water is truly breathtaking and is a must-see for nature enthusiasts.

In addition to the waterfall, the Ruby Falls area offers hiking trails, picnic areas, and bre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ape. It is a perfect spot for a day trip or a weekend getaway.

Cumberland Caverns

Cumberland Caverns is a fascinating underground wonder in Tennessee. Located near McMinnville, this cave system allows visitors to explore its vast network of chambers and tunnels.

The caverns are known for stunning rock formations, including stalactites and stalagmites. Guided tours are available, providing an informative and exciting experience. Visitors can learn about the history and geology of the caves while marveling at their natural beauty.

Lost Sea Adventure

The Lost Sea Adventure is a must-visit attraction in Tennessee. This underground lake, located in Sweetwater, offers a unique and thrilling experience for visitors.

As you explore the cave system, you’ll come across the largest underground lake in the United States, spanning over four acres.

The lake’s crystal-clear waters are home to various fascinating marine life, including blind cavefish.

The guided tours of the Lost Sea Adventure provide an exciting opportunity to learn about the geological formations and history of the cave. It’s a great place to escape the summer heat or to explore during your winter vacation.
